Output 4953defba9916abc9e5ece4b64329fe80b5fbcfeeb7bf1ad773ec8795de9333e:13

value
292631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f32d62a8ac1d9b27e7a1a892c3563267f483413 OP_EQUAL
address
3EkBTASA2HY76fpP8fwvzX1hX3c5fFKBVN
transaction
4953defba9916abc9e5ece4b64329fe80b5fbcfeeb7bf1ad773ec8795de9333e
confirmations
392391
spent
true